RISD PreK/Headstart for ages 3 or 4
2019-2020 Robstown ISD Pre-K Full Day- Head Start Partner
Free Full Day Pre-Kindergarten and Headstart for eligible 3 and 4 year olds
Early childhood education is vitally important to your child's development and school-readiness. Eligible PK3 and 4 year old children will receive:
- FREE full day of instruction
- FREE breakfast, lunch and snack
- Applications accepted for Head Start and Children with Disabilities

Head Start ages 3-4 is located at Robert Driscoll Elementary School
PK is available at all three RISD Elementary Campuses (Robert Driscoll ES, Lotspeich ES, San Pedro ES).
Students that do not qualify for free PK may apply to our classroom at Lotspeich Elementary (space is limited).
What to Bring?
- Birth Certificate for the child
- 2019 proof of income from all adults in household (current check stub, W-2, or food stamp eligibility letter)
- Parent's Photo ID
- Child's Social Security Card (if available)
- Child's Immunization Record/Medical Information
- Proof of Residency
- Proof of Guardianship if applicable (example: child is not currently residing with parent)
- Verification documents, if needed, could include food stamps/SNAP, medicaid, employment, school record, public housing residency, section 8 residency, domestic violence, incarceration, current immunizations, current physical, current dental
Robstown ISD accepts students outside district boundaries--apply for an out of district transfer
